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ance. Other than that, Passmark measures multi-core performance.

Xeon W-2135 has a 543.3% higher aggregate performance score, and 200% more physical cores and 500% more threads.

Celeron N6211, on the other hand, has an age advantage of 4 years, a 40% more advanced lithography process, and 13900% lower power consumption.

The Intel Xeon W-2135 is our recommended choice as it beats the Intel Celeron N6211 in performance tests.

Be aware that Xeon W-2135 is a server/workstation processor while Celeron N6211 is a desktop one.
